Letter to The British Lighting & Ignition Co. Ltd. acknowledging receipt of an electrolytic voltage control and a 20 HP chassis dynamo for testing.

Dear Sirs,

We have duly received sample of your electrolytic
voltage control, together with our 20 H.P. chassis dynamo,
loaned to you for the purpose of conversion, also your letter
of the 17th inst and notes on the functioning of the
system.

Tests of the system will be put in hand as
soon as the completion of other work will permit.
